UK general insurer LV= has revealed plans for the launch of its new business unit, ABC Insurance, in the broker market in June 2007, with a new corporate brand.

The new arm will begin to underwrite both personal and commercial insurance for small to medium sized enterprises exclusively through brokers. The business will initially employ up to 30 people at its new headquarters in Croydon.

Initially, ABC Insurance will launch a business insurance product in June 2007, followed by a private car product later in the year.

LV= has also revealed the ambitious targets of the new business, with aims of writing GBP300 million of premium income over the next four years.
